Detailed 1/700 Representation of the 1915 Dreadnought

The Trumpeter 06705 kit recreates the 1915 HMS Dreadnought in 1/700 scale, focusing on authentic hull lines and deck fittings for display-grade builds. It is aimed at hobbyists who value historical fidelity and a refined finish for shelf or diorama presentation.

The Dreadnought changed naval architecture with its all-big-gun layout and steam turbine drive, and this model mirrors those innovations with precision-molded parts and crisp surface detail. Builders with some kit experience will find the assembly rewarding, with careful gluing and painting needed to show off the fine components.

  • Scale: 1/700
  • Material: Plastic
  • Assembly Type: Requires glue
  • Paint and decals: Not included
This kit is best for intermediate to experienced modellers because of small parts and detailed assemblies. Beginners can build it but should expect to spend extra time on trimming and fit.
A painting guide is included to help match hull and superstructure colors, while decals are not supplied so plan for aftermarket markings or hand-painting details.
Use a fine applicator cyanoacrylate or plastic cement for strong joints, and employ tweezers, a sharp hobby knife, and fine files to handle and clean tiny components safely.
